Question 675276: suppose a computer virus begins by infecting 8 computers in the first hour after it is released. each hour after that, each newly infected computer causes 8 more computers to become infected. the function y=8^x models this situation.make a table with integer values of x from 1 to 4

x y = 8^x
1 8
2 64
3 512
4 4096
